Faculty Compensation and Workload

Full-time
Faculty
190
As a rule, properly compensated instructors are better motivated and have more opportunities to concentrate on teaching; therefore, we consider faculty compensation to be an important factor for evaluating education quality.

Faculty monthly salaries at Bluegrass Community and Technical College vary approximately from $4,000 to $7,000. The average full-time faculty salary at this college is approximately $66,000 a year - that is 30% lower than Kentucky average faculty compensation.

Women faculty members at this college are paid $5,336 a month on average; that is about the same as average men faculty salaries, $5,608 a month.

Bluegrass Community and Technical College has a reasonably decent, 18:1 students-to-faculty ratio.

Low ratios usually imply smaller class size, more attention to students, better quality of education, and higher satisfaction both for students and instructors. High ratios are usually a sign of the opposite.

Faculty Ranking and Demographics

The full-time faculty at Bluegrass Community and Technical College consists of 54 professors, 50 associate professors, 30 assistant professors, 51 instructors, and 5 lecturers - 84 men and 106 women:
